How Induction Cooking Works

Unlike traditional stoves, induction cooktops generate heat directly in the bottom of the pot through a magnetic field. This means faster cooking, less heat loss, and energy consumption reduced by up to 50%.

Features of Compatible Cookware

Not all pots work on induction cooktops. Here’s what to look for:

  • Ferromagnetic bottom: The material must contain iron to interact with the magnetic field
  • Flat and thick bottom: Ensures optimal contact with the cooktop and even heat distribution
  • Proper diameter: The bottom must cover at least 70% of the cooking zone
  • Compatibility symbol: Look for the spiral symbol on the bottom of the pot

The Best Materials for Induction

Stainless steel with magnetic bottom: Durable, stylish, and easy to clean. Ideal for cooking sauces, risottos, and boiled dishes.

Cast iron: Retains heat exceptionally well, perfect for braising and slow cooking. Requires more maintenance but lasts a lifetime.

Aluminum with ferromagnetic disc: Lightweight and with excellent thermal conductivity, perfect for quick and even cooking.

Quick Compatibility Test

Not sure if your pots work on induction? Try the magnet test: if a magnet sticks to the bottom of the pot, it is compatible!

Maintenance Tips

  • Clean the induction cooktop after each use to avoid burnt residues
  • Avoid dragging pots across the surface to prevent scratches
  • Use pots with perfectly clean and dry bottoms
  • Gradually adjust the power to preserve the non-stick coating
